Manuport Logistics Implements Descartes' Ocean eBooking Solution

Descartes' Ocean eBooking solution is designed to execute and transmit electronic bookings to ocean carriers via Descartes' Global Logistics Network (GLN).

Waterloo, Ontario—April 26, 2012Descartes Systems Group, a global provider of cloud-based logistics technology solutions, announced that global freight forwarder Manuport Logistics, Lier, Belgium, deployed Descartes' Ocean eBooking solution, which is designed to execute and transmit electronic bookings to ocean carriers via Descartes' Global Logistics Network (GLN).

“The primary reason we deployed electronic bookings was to increase the quality of our overall shipping process,” said Vibeke Geerts, Head of IT for Manuport Logistics. “Descartes' eBooking solution was a natural extension to our existing GLN solutions for ocean shipping instructions and container status events. By moving from manual to electronic bookings with our carrier community, we've been able to streamline and further optimize our operations. We've also been able to enhance our customer portal with improved visibility now that communication across the complete ocean shipment lifecycle is managed electronically.”

Descartes' eBooking solution handles the complexity of the multi-party process for entering, sending, confirming and managing amendments to booking requests between forwarders or shippers and ocean carriers and their agents. It improves accuracy by reducing rekeying errors, validating information and ensuring completeness of mandatory fields at the initial source of data input. Additionally, shipment data from previous bookings and sailing information from carriers can be repurposed and reused throughout the process. Customers benefit from connectivity and real-time access to the industry's broadest network of ocean carriers, non-vessel operating common carriers (NVOCCs), and shipping agents.
